Why It Makes Sense to Buy Small Gold Bars
When looking at the price of one ounce of gold, it might be rather alarming.
- • Investors can enter the market without having to make significant initial investments because of smaller denominations. Bullion portfolios can be initiated by purchasing a gold bar weighing either 1 gram or 2.5 grams.
- • A gold bar weighing 1 gram is the most affordable option, while a gold bar weighing 2.5 grams offers a slightly greater ratio of gold to premium. Due to this flexibility, customers can make purchases based on their budget and the timing of the market rather than saving up for bigger purchases.
- • When it comes to liquidity, little gold bars have a big edge. A gold bar that weighs 1 or 2.5 grams is more likely to sell in a hurry than a big one.
- • These little gold bars are not only inexpensive but also appealing, making them excellent presents. A present that is both considerate and precious is a PAMP Suisse or Perth Mint bar that weighs either one gram or two and a half grams and comes in a branded assay card.
- • Storing the gold bars that weigh 1 and 2.5 grams is a simple task. They are small enough to be stored in a home safe, a deposit box, or an inconspicuous location due to their small size.
